What exactly are Stem Cells?

Stem cells are unspecialized cells capable of dividing and renewing themselves around prolonged periods. Compared with other cells, which include skin or liver cells, that are differentiated and perform precise features, stem cells have two distinctive Homes:

Self-renewal: They're able to divide and produce extra stem cells.
Differentiation: They could create into specialised cells with certain capabilities in the body.

These properties make them priceless for restoring and regenerating broken tissues and organs.
Different types of Stem Cells

Stem cells might be categorised into numerous types centered on their supply and potential to differentiate into other cells. The main sorts consist of:
1. Embryonic Stem Cells (ESCs)

Embryonic stem cells are derived from early-phase embryos, ordinarily from the ones that are 3 to 5 times previous, during a developmental stage called the blastocyst. These stem cells are pluripotent, that means they will give increase to virtually any kind of mobile during the human body, creating them particularly multipurpose for research and therapeutic functions.

ESCs are An important concentrate in health-related investigation because of their probable to regenerate weakened tissues or treat degenerative illnesses including Parkinson’s ailment, spinal twine injuries, or diabetes. Nevertheless, the use of ESCs can also be controversial since obtaining them requires the destruction of an embryo, raising moral fears.
two. Adult Stem Cells (ASCs)

Adult stem cells, also referred to as somatic or tissue-particular stem cells, are located in many tissues through the overall body, including the bone marrow, brain, pores and skin, liver, and muscles. Contrary to embryonic stem cells, ASCs are multipotent, indicating They can be constrained in the types of cells they can become. For example, hematopoietic stem cells from bone marrow can only generate blood cells, not nerve or muscle mass cells.

Adult stem cells are fewer controversial than ESCs since they may be harvested from your patient’s have human body without having destroying embryos. In addition, employing a affected person's own stem cells for therapies lessens the risk of immune rejection. Having said that, they've more minimal possible for differentiation in comparison to embryonic stem cells.
three. Induced Pluripotent Stem Cells (iPSCs)

Induced pluripotent stem cells are Grownup cells that have been genetically reprogrammed to behave like embryonic stem cells, indicating they regain pluripotency. This groundbreaking discovery, initially accomplished in 2006 by Japanese scientist Shinya Yamanaka, revolutionized stem mobile analysis. The entire process of building iPSCs includes introducing specific genes into adult cells (e.g., pores and skin or blood cells), which turns them again into an undifferentiated, embryonic-like point out.

iPSCs are a substantial breakthrough because they provide a way to acquire pluripotent stem cells without the ethical troubles associated with embryonic stem cells. They also maintain the likely for individualized drugs, where a affected person’s possess cells is often reprogrammed to take care of health conditions.
four. Mesenchymal Stem Cells (MSCs)

Mesenchymal stem cells really are a kind of adult stem cell found in bone marrow, fat, and umbilical cord tissue. They're known for their ability to differentiate into cells that type bone, cartilage, muscle, and fat tissues. MSCs are widely studied for his or her opportunity in tissue engineering and regenerative drugs, specifically for fixing ruined joints, dealing with autoimmune illnesses, and decreasing inflammation.
Sources of Stem Cells

Stem cells is usually sourced from many sites in the human body or derived in laboratory options. A few of the most common resources contain:
1. Bone Marrow

Bone marrow has been a perfectly-regarded source of stem cells, particularly hematopoietic stem cells, which deliver blood cells. For many years, bone marrow transplants happen to be used to take care of problems like leukemia and also other blood Ailments.
2. Umbilical Wire Blood

After a baby is born, the blood still left within the umbilical wire and placenta includes hematopoietic stem cells. Wire blood stem cells are considerably less experienced than adult stem cells, earning them far more adaptable. They are Utilized in treatments for blood Conditions and immune program disorders, and lots of mom and dad decide to lender their child’s wire blood for possible long run medical use.
3. Peripheral Blood

Peripheral blood stem cells is often collected from your bloodstream utilizing a process referred to as apheresis. This technique involves drawing blood, isolating the stem cells, and afterwards returning the remaining blood components to the human body. These stem cells are more and more Utilized in therapies for cancer clients going through chemotherapy or radiation treatment plans.
four. Induced Stem Cells

As talked about earlier, iPSCs are developed by reprogramming adult cells to an embryonic-like condition. Due to the fact these cells can be generated from a patient’s personal cells, they present an fascinating avenue for customized regenerative medication.
Programs of Stem Cells

Stem cell study holds assure for managing a variety of disorders and accidents, with programs in regenerative medicine, drug testing, and disease modeling.
one. Regenerative Medication

Among the most interesting programs of stem cells is in regenerative medicine, where they may be utilized to mend or substitute broken tissues. For instance, experts are Discovering the use of stem cells stem cell thailand to regenerate damaged coronary heart tissue after a coronary heart attack, rebuild neurons in individuals with spinal wire injuries, as well as grow new organs for transplantation.
2. Stem Cells and Neurodegenerative Health conditions

Stem cells present likely remedies for neurodegenerative diseases like Alzheimer’s, Parkinson’s, and many sclerosis. By replacing harmed or dying neurons, stem cell therapies could assistance restore dropped function in clients suffering from these debilitating ailments.
3. Drug Tests and Condition Modeling

Stem cells will also be Utilized in drug tests and illness modeling. By building condition-unique stem cell traces, experts can research how a disorder develops in the cellular amount, check new prescription drugs for efficacy, and display for opportunity Uncomfortable side effects. For example, iPSCs from sufferers with genetic health conditions may be differentiated into influenced tissues (which include neurons or heart cells) to study the condition in a very lab.
four. Most cancers Research

Stem cells are instrumental in cancer investigation, specially in researching how most cancers develops and spreads. Most cancers stem cells, a little subpopulation of cells within tumors, are believed for being answerable for most cancers recurrence and resistance to procedure. Understanding these cells could lead to more effective therapies targeting the root triggers of cancer.
Problems and Ethical Concerns

Although the prospective for stem cell therapies is immense, the field faces several challenges, such as technical, moral, and regulatory difficulties.
one. Specialized Hurdles

Stem cell research remains in its early phases, and there are several troubles to overcome prior to stem mobile-dependent therapies turn into extensively accessible. Issues which include guaranteeing the safety and extensive-expression balance of stem mobile-derived tissues, keeping away from immune rejection, and reaching the specific differentiation of stem cells into sought after cell forms have to be dealt with.
2. Moral Considerations

Using embryonic stem cells has sparked ethical debates, significantly regarding the destruction of embryos to acquire these cells. Some argue that this process destroys probable human existence, while others feel that the possible professional medical Positive aspects outweigh these concerns. The development of iPSCs has served mitigate some ethical troubles, but concerns with regards to the manipulation of human cells stay.
three. Regulatory Worries

Stem cell therapies have to undertake rigorous medical tests and fulfill regulatory needs right before they can be accredited to be used in people. Numerous experimental solutions remain in the early stages of advancement, and navigating the regulatory landscape is often elaborate and time-consuming.
